A 65-year-old woman was admitted with shortness of breath and chest pain. A computed tomographic angiogram of the chest performed for suspected pulmonary embolism showed a filling defect in the left atrium, concerning for a tumor or thrombus (Figure, A). Transesophageal echocardiography revealed a large mobile mass in the left atrium attached to the interatrial septum with a very short pedicle (Figure, B and Movie I in the online-only Data Supplement).
